Our primary focus is supporting other charitable organizations by providing construction expertise and assistance while also undertaking small projects of our own. By connecting industry professionals with passionate volunteers, we help deliver high-quality new and renovated spaces that empower organizations to better serve their communities.
Building Goodness Foundation at Virginia Tech was formed in 2017. As a student-run organization we are 100% funded through donations. This past year our team built a barn door for Mountain View Humane Clinic in Christiansburg, Virginia. We have also built an oversized Jenga set and a little free library for the Community Housing Partners to support their local after-school programs. Currently, our team is working on projects with the Roanoke Valley SPCA and Mountain View Humane Clinic.
